gmp_random_range
Function • Params and return types changed in PHP 8.0
Get a uniformly selected integer.
gmp_random_range Function synopsis
gmp_random_range(GMP|string|int $min, GMP|string|int $max): GMP
Parameters
$min
TypeGMP|string|int
A GMP number representing the lower bound for the random number
$max
TypeGMP|string|int
A GMP number representing the upper bound for the random number
Return value
TypeGMP
Returns a GMP object which contains
a uniformly selected integer from the closed interval
[$min, $max]. Both
$min and $max are
possible return values.
Changes to the gmp_random_range Function
PHP 8.0
- Return type added:
GMP - Parameter type added for parameter #1 (
$min):GMP|string|int - Parameter type added for parameter #2 (
$max):GMP|string|int
- gmp_random_range($min, $max)
+ gmp_random_range(GMP|string|int $min, GMP|string|int $max): GMP PHP 5.6
- Function added
